What's This Valve All About?

The pressure relief valve plays an irreplaceable role in maintaining that cozy cabin environment while we soar high in the sky. Its primary job? Preventing cabin pressure from exceeding ambient pressure. You know those tight, uncomfortable feelings in your ears when you quickly ascend in an airplane? Imagine the ramifications if the cabin pressure went haywire fundamentally. Structural damage? Cabin integrity at risk? Not on our watch!

Let’s Get Technical—A Little!

Picture this: you're cruising at 30,000 feet, and suddenly the aircraft starts climbing fast. The pressure inside that cozy cabin needs to be regulated like a well-tuned instrument. If cabin pressure exceeds what’s considered safe and exceeds the ambient pressure outside, it can compromise the aircraft’s structure. Nobody wants to think about a hull rupture mid-flight, right? The pressure relief valve is there to save the day, helping maintain that delicate equilibrium between cabin and ambient pressures.
